Lajon Witherspoon of Sevendust has a new favorite band in Bad Omens

Sevendust vocalist Lajon Witherspoon has been tearing it up on the stage and in the studio for decades at this point. So, it’s time for Witherspoon to start looking around and getting to know some of the up-and-coming talent in the heavy music world. After all, perhaps some of these younger rockers will help keep the flame of rock and metal alive for the next generation.

Speaking with Audio Ink Radio in a recent interview, Witherspoon gushed over a newer band that he learned about through his daughter. That band is rising metalcore stars Bad Omens. He went to see them live during their North American tour last spring and was more than impressed.

So, how did the topic of Bad Omens come up in the interview? During the chat, Audio Ink Radio’s Anne Erickson mentioned that she recently went to one of her first indoor concerts in several years, following the shutdowns. Witherspoon asked which band she went to see live, and when Erickson answered “Bad Omens,” he got excited.

“Oh, my!” he exclaimed. “The reason I yelled so bad is because I went on Instagram live while watching my son take his little a lesson today in soccer at the high school. I let my daughter drive me in her new Volkswagen Bug. So, she drove me up there, and she was like, I’m going to sit in my car, dad. I was like, all right, cool, why don’t you turn your system up, because you have a nice little system there. Let me see if I can hear it. And she text me, and she’s like, are you ready? I’m like, yeah. And she’s rocking out. So, I’m walking up, and I’m like, what are you listening to there? And she’s like, Bad Omens.”

“So, I took them to the show two weeks ago,” he added. “The whole family went to see Bad Omens… It was great, man. I’ve never seen those guys…it was sold out. It was great.”

Bad Omens released their latest album, “The Death of Peace of Mind,” in 2022. One of the songs off the album, “Just Pretend,” went viral on TikTok, which introduced Bad Omens to a whole new demographic. Now, Bad Omens are out on a fall North American headline tour. The trek currently runs through mid-October, and many of the dates have sold out.

Meanwhile, Sevendust released their 14th studio album, “Truth Killer,” earlier this year. The band will embark on a tour with fellow metal bands Static-X and Dope this fall to promote the release. That tour kicks off Oct. 6 in Houston, Texas, and runs through early November.
